We are looking for a Full Stack Web Developer to building new solution in Node, Typescript, and Azure or AWS cloud environment to replace our current on-prem Advertising Campaigns Management solution
Essential Technical Knowledge
- Advanced JavaScript/TypeScript proficiency
- Solid front-end development experience with React.js
- Deep knowledge of modern UI frameworks and responsive design
- Back-end development experience with your preferred language
- SQL and NoSQL database management skills
- Knowledge of microservices architecture
- Experience implementing and managing RESTful APIs
- Version control proficiency with Git
- Knowledge of CI/CD and DevOps methodologies
- Experience with automated testing (unit, integration, e2e)
Soft Skills
- Ability to learn quickly to understand the US Media business
- Ability to work autonomously
- Ability to solve complex problems
- Good communication and documentation skills
- Focus on detail and code quality
Main Responsibilities
- Continue the development of the new MMS 2.0 following the established architecture
- Implement pending modules (offline, out-of-home, broadcast) based on the online module template
- Maintain consistency in design and user experience throughout the system
- Ensure code scalability and maintainability
- Implement integrations with external systems when necessary
- Collaborate with the business team to understand and meet the specific requirements of each module
Project Management Skills
- Ability to work with agile methodologies (Scrum, Kanban)
- Ability to estimate time and resources
- Experience with technical system documentation
- Ability to communicate effectively with non-technical stakeholders
MMS 2.0 Project Specific Knowledge
- Understanding of the system's modular structure (online, offline, out-of-home, broadcast)
- Ability to maintain design consistency across modules
- Understanding of business processes in the advertising industry
- Knowledge of billing and contract management systems
- Ability to implement effective reporting solutions
Specific Experience
- Minimum 3-5 years of experience in full-stack web development
- Previous experience rebuilding/modernizing legacy systems (desirable)
- Knowledge of advertising management or adtech systems (desirable)
- Experience developing dashboards and data visualization
- Ability to design and implement scalable architectures (absolutely necessary)
- Experience integrating with external systems (such as Pipedrive)